How Much Do Electrician Services Cost in Farmington?

In Farmington, you can generally expect to pay between $38 and $57 per hour for electrical work. To estimate the complete cost of your electrical job, electricians will consider how long it will take and the potential need for new equipment. Companies may also have higher rates for jobs that are complex, risky, or need more than one worker on the job.

What Services Do Electricians Offer?

Skilled Farmington electricians provide a comprehensive range of services, ranging from minor fixes to whole-home electrical overhauls. Common offerings encompass the following:

  • System installation: Electricians can install new electrical systems, such as appliances or outdoor lighting. When you contact a local electrician for an installation estimate, tell them whether you already have the equipment or are seeking comprehensive ordering and installation services.
  • Electrical repairs: If the electrical outlets in your bedroom stop working or your fridge stops cooling, an electrician can diagnose and fix the issue. Farmington electricians can perform complimentary inspections to assess the issue, identify potential causes, and prepare an estimate for fixes.
  • Electrical upgrades: Professional electricians can handle upgrades like modernizing the electrical setup in your home. A pro can replace old prong outlets with larger-capacity prong outlets and exchange outdated wires for modern, better-insulated alternatives. Hiring a licensed electrician is also the best choice for panel upgrades.
  • Surge protection: A certified electrician can assess your home’s electrical setup and implement surge protection measures at key points to shield you and your electronics. Investing in a surge protection system can save you money in the long run.

What are the Licensing Requirements for Electricians in Connecticut?

Doing electrical work has serious safety risks if you aren't trained. For a safe outcome, always hire an electrician who has the right skills and background. Electricians in Farmington need an Electrical license from the Connecticut Department of Consumer Protection . The state offers ten different licenses that allow electricians to do specific types of jobs, such as high-voltage systems and fire alarms. Ensure the company you choose has technicians licensed for your specific job.

Some electricians hold additional certifications from organizations such as the Occupational Safety and Health Administration. By earning additional certifications, an electrician shows their dedication to staying up to date with best practices and safety standards. Be sure to ask each electrician about any additional training they've received.

Have your home's electrical panels and systems examined every 3–5 years. Once an electrician examines your system, they can resolve any pressing issues and suggest cost-saving upgrades.

To prevent electrical fires and power surges, install devices like GFCI outlets, whole-house surge protectors, and AFCI breakers according to your electrician's recommendations and local codes. Don't overload outlets with multiple power strips or large appliances, and never try to plug a three-prong plug into a two-prong outlet. If you notice hot outlets or switch plates, flickering lights, sparks, or burning smells, disable power to the area immediately and contact your electrician.

Rising power bills are one sign that it's time for an electrical upgrade, as your energy consumption can increase with old or defective devices. Some other signs of larger electrical issues include odd smells, hot outlets, tripped circuit breakers, sparks, or flickering lights. If you see any of these signs, disconnect power to the area right away and contact an electrician in Farmington.
